Name: Novobiocin calcium
CAS#: 4309-70-0 (Ca)
Chemical Formula: C62H70CaN4O22
Exact Mass: 1,262.41
Molecular Weight: 1,263.330
Elemental Analysis: C, 58.95; H, 5.59; Ca, 3.17; N, 4.43; O, 27.86

Synonym: Albamycin, Novobiocin calcium

IUPAC/Chemical Name: calcium 7-(((2R,3R,4S,5R)-4-(carbamoyloxy)-3-hydroxy-5-methoxy-6,6-dimethyltetrahydro-2H-pyran-2-yl)oxy)-3-(4-hydroxy-3-(3-methylbut-2-en-1-yl)benzamido)-8-methyl-2-oxo-2H-chromen-4-olate

InChi Key: HEJBMFPJLCJWER-CWPVBXIBSA-L

InChi Code: 1S/2C31H36N2O11.Ca/c2*1-14(2)7-8-16-13-17(9-11-19(16)34)27(37)33-21-22(35)18-10-12-20(15(3)24(18)42-28(21)38)41-29-23(36)25(43-30(32)39)26(40-6)31(4,5)44-29;/h2*7,9-13,23,25-26,29,34-36H,8H2,1-6H3,(H2,32,39)(H,33,37);/q;;+2/p-2/t2*23-,25+,26-,29-;/m11./s1

SMILES Code: [Ca+2].CO[C@@H]1[C@@H](OC(=O)N)[C@@H](O)[C@H](Oc2ccc3C(=C(NC(=O)c4ccc(O)c(CC=C(C)C)c4)C(=O)Oc3c2C)[O-])OC1(C)C.CO[C@@H]5[C@@H](OC(=O)N)[C@@H](O)[C@H](Oc6ccc7C(=C(NC(=O)c8ccc(O)c(CC=C(C)C)c8)C(=O)Oc7c6C)[O-])OC5(C)C

Appearance: Solid powder

Purity: >98% (or refer to the Certificate of Analysis)

Shipping Condition: Shipped under ambient temperature as non-hazardous chemical. This product is stable enough for a few weeks during ordinary shipping and time spent in Customs.

Storage Condition: Dry, dark and at 0 - 4 C for short term (days to weeks) or -20 C for long term (months to years).

Solubility: Soluble in DMSO

Shelf Life: >3 years if stored properly
